Ni₂MnGe is an intermetallic compound belonging to the Heusler alloy family, characterized by a specific stoichiometric composition of nickel, manganese, and germanium. This material is primarily investigated in research and advanced applications contexts rather than established high-volume industrial production, with particular interest in magnetic and shape-memory alloy communities. Ni₂MnGe exhibits potential for applications requiring magnetic functionality or shape-memory behavior, positioning it as a candidate material for next-generation actuators, sensors, and thermal management devices where conventional ferrous or copper-based alloys are insufficient.
